Across TCGA pan-cancer cohorts, CHAF1B RNA is linked to patient survival in 28 of 34 cancer types, making it the most broadly survival-associated CHAF1B data layer compared with 2 for mutation status and 5 for mass-spec protein.
The strongest signal is observed in adrenocortical carcinoma (ACC), where higher CHAF1B RNA is associated with worse disease-free survival. In most high-consensus cancer types, elevated CHAF1B expression acts as an unfavorable survival marker, although some lineages such as READ and SKCM show a favorable association.
ACC, KIRP, and MESO are the cancer types where CHAF1B RNA most reproducibly stratifies survival.
